Rally To Call For Overpass

Your browser doesn’t support HTML5 audio

A demonstration is planned for Friday in Evansville to push for a pedestrian bridge over Highway 41. 

Indivisible Evansville, Brothers Saving Souls, and student activists from area high schools will rally at the intersection of U.S. 41 and Washington Avenue – and they’re expected to chant “build that bridge!”

In a news release, Indivisible says the lack of a pedestrian overpass at the intersection impacts the safety of Bosse High School and Washington Middle School students.

The group is calling on the City of Evansville to find the money and prioritize the overpass with state legislators.  

INDOT crews examined the intersection Wednesday, taking measurements, watching pedestrian and vehicular traffic, and assessing how the intersection is currently operating.

The rally is planned for 3 p.m. Friday.
